International Business & Commerce Schools in Idaho

18 students earned International Business degrees in Idaho in the <nil> year.

As a degree choice, International Business & Commerce is the 15th most popular major in the state.

Racial Distribution

The racial distribution of international business majors in Idaho is as follows:

  • Asian: 5.6%
  • Black or African American: 0.0%
  • Hispanic or Latino: 11.1%
  • White: 61.1%
  • Non-Resident Alien: 16.7%
  • Other Races: 5.6%

Jobs for International Business & Commerce Grads in Idaho

In this state, there are 13,570 people employed in jobs related to an international business degree, compared to 2,569,530 nationwide.

undefined

Wages for International Business & Commerce Jobs in Idaho

A typical salary for a international business grad in the state is $84,330, compared to a typical salary of $123,880 nationwide.
